A deep, darky, brooding Amarone. Raisiny, chalky, hot, medicinal, rich, thick, dense, big, bold, complex, unabashed and boisterous. Definitely has an "A" type personality. Tannins are in check, and acidity is detected, but this guy derives his structure primarily from alcohol. Mr. Lawrason's wine writer technical term sums it up best - wowser! Enjoy with the darkest of chocolate or blue cheese or parmigiano nibbles topped with a drop of honey. Feb. 2014.
